How to propagate heartleaf vine by cuttings

1. Cutting time

It is critical to choose the right time for cuttings. The time for cuttings of heartleaf vine can be selected from May to September. The climate during this period is more suitable for cuttings, and the survival rate is relatively high. Cuttings can also be taken in other seasons, but the survival rate is not as high as in that period.

2. Cut the stem nodes

Choose plants with vigorous growth and good growth. Cut off strong stem nodes from the top. It is required to have good growth and no influence of diseases and pests. 2-3 nodes should be retained on the top. A leaf can be retained on the top, and the leaves below need to be removed. Not too many leaves can be retained, otherwise evaporation will be strong, which is not conducive to rooting and survival in the later stage. After cutting, you cannot do cuttings immediately. You can put it aside to dry first, so that the bottom can become slightly dry.

3. Preparation of matrix

The choice of substrate is also very important. You can use coarse sand or sphagnum moss. Keeping the substrate moist can promote rooting in the later stage.

4. Take cuttings

After all these are prepared, you need to carry out cuttings. Dip the cut stem nodes in rooting powder and then insert them into the substrate. Do a good job of post-care and keep the temperature at 22-24 degrees Celsius. The cuttings will take root in about 20-25 days after cutting.
